How can I check if the values are unique in an array based on the key value? Below is the out put of the array. I want to remove duplicate values based on the “id” key. If you check below, the 2nd & 3rd array are same except for the “role” value. Because of this, array_unique is not working on this array.

array
  0 => 
    array
      'id' => string '1521422' (length=7)
      'name' => string 'David Alvarado' (length=14)
      'role' => string 'associate producer  ' (length=20)
  1 => 
    array
      'id' => string '0098210' (length=7)
      'name' => string 'Cristian Bostanescu' (length=19)
      'role' => string 'line producer: Romania  (as Cristi Bostanescu)' (length=46)
  2 => 
    array
      'id' => string '1266015' (length=7)
      'name' => string 'Bruno Hoefler' (length=13)
      'role' => string 'co-producer  ' (length=13)
  3 => 
    array
      'id' => string '1266015' (length=7)
      'name' => string 'Bruno Hoefler' (length=13)
      'role' => string 'executive producer  ' (length=20)
  4 => 
    array
      'id' => string '1672379' (length=7)
      'name' => string 'Alwyn Kushner' (length=13)
      'role' => string 'associate producer  ' (length=20)

    Try this one:

    <?php
    $array = array(
        array('id' => 1, 'text' => 'a'),
        array('id' => 2, 'text' => 'b'),
        array('id' => 1, 'text' => 'c'),
        array('id' => 3, 'text' => 'd')
    );
    $array = array_filter($array, function ($item) {
        static $found = array();
        if (isset($found[$item['id']])) return false;
        $found[$item['id']] = true;
        return true;
    });
    
    var_dump($array);
    

    This works as of PHP 5.3 (because of the closure and static statement).

    cf. http://php.net/manual/en/function.array-filter.php for more information. I tested the statement within loops, it works there as well.
